The public high schools with the highest share of Asian students in Belknap County, New Hampshire

Across Belknap County, New Hampshire, 6 public high schools are ranked here, ranked by the share of students who are Asian, from federal NCES enrollment data. Laconia High School leads the list at 1.4%, against a median of 1.1% across the ranked schools.

#SchoolCityDistrictStudentsAsian students% Asian
1Laconia High SchoolLaconia, NHLaconia School District56281.4%
2Gilford High SchoolGilford, NHGilford School District47061.3%
3Winnisquam Regional High SchoolTilton, NHWinnisquam Regional School District35741.1%
4Inter-Lakes High SchoolMeredith, NHInter-Lakes Cooperative School District29431.0%
5Prospect Mountain High SchoolAlton, NHProspect Mountain JMA School District40230.8%
6Belmont High SchoolBelmont, NHShaker Regional School District36100.0%
